The Jackbox Party Pack 8 is available now on P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Nintendo Switch, and PC/Mac/Linux via Steam and the Epic Games Store. Drawful: Animate: The original Jackbox picture game returns! Now with additional potential for animated gifs to assist in duping the other players. Knowledge will get you far, and fate will seal the win! The Wheel of Enormous Proportions: Trivia and chance combine in this game hosted by the all-powerful Wheel.Can you guess which weapons belong to everyone else in this drawing deduction game – whilst covering your own tracks? Weapons Drawn: Who is the murderer?! Well, everyone actually.The Poll Mine: Answer survey questions and guess how your allies will respond as well in the first ever Jackbox team game!.Whoever scores the most points will score the Job (Job)! Job Job: Answer questions, and then use each other's words in an attempt to ace the job interview.With four all-new ideas and one spin on an old classic, there's sure to be something to suit everyone's tastes.
